About This Opportunity
This PhD scholarship is associated with developing a Digital Twin-Driven model for mapping part quality in Multi Jet Fusion manufacturing for automotive parts in mass production with Ford Motor Company. The scholarship provides support for doctoral research focused on advanced manufacturing processes and digital twin technologies for automotive applications. The research will involve international collaboration and travel opportunities to the United States and the United Kingdom. The scholarship is designed to support research that bridges industry needs with academic innovation in the field of advanced manufacturing and digital modeling.
